THIS IS WHAT THE TRACTOR DID. IT WAS RUNNING FINE. THE SPEED WENT DOWN FOR ABOUT 30 SECONDS. PUFFED BLACK SMOKE EVERYWHERE AND DIED. IT WOULD NOT CRANK AGAIN. IT APPEARED LOCKED UP. THEN AFTER ABOUT 45 MINUTES IT STARTED AGAIN. PUFFED SMOKE LIKE CRAZY AND RAN FOR ABOUT 3 MINUTES. DIED AGAIN MAKING VERY BAD NOISES. I REMOVED THE OIL PAN EXPECTING TO FIND SEVERE DAMAGE. EVERYTHING LOOKS GOOD. THE STARTER WOULD TURN THE ENGINE ABOUT 2 DEGREES WITH EACH CLICK. NOW IT DOESN'T DO THAT EITHER. NORE CAN I MOVE IT BY HAND. I CAN'T SEE IN FRONT WERE THE GEARS ARE, OIL PUMP, INJECTOR PUMP, ETC. I THINK THE DAMAGE IS SOMEWHERE IN FRONT.
